NBCUniversal has an employee rating of 3.9 out of 5 stars, based on 5,306 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The NBCUniversal employ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Media & Communication industry (3.7 stars).

Pros

feels like a family, there are always big company milestones to look forward to, HR is supportive of moving around within the company

Cons

sometimes the company feels too big, especially with all the recent acquisitions and partnerships, making it difficult to get things done. also, the salaries are below marketplace making it difficult to stay

Pros

A lot of nice people work there. Good fun to work on the lot in Universal City. Perks/discounts at Universal Studios / CityWalk

Cons

Elitist culture Experience not valued Unqualified people promoted over true team players. Lack of true concern for providing excellent services to business units. Top brass excuse poor performance and dissatisfied clients by stating department is in "transition" Morale is horrible and no one seems to notice or care Leadership skills are lacking Poor / No communication - not once was I asked what I was working on Blind eye to a lot of deadbeat employees Disconnect between values of Steve Burke and this department.
